				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>BioWare announced today that the <em>Mass Effect 3: Extended Cut</em>, a piece of downloadable content available at no additional charge* that expands upon the ending to the <em>Mass Effect</em> trilogy, is available today. <span id="more-7533"></span>As we <a title="Mass Effect 3: Extended Cut What You Need To Know" href="http://ghoststorm.co.uk/mass-effect-3-extended-cut-what-you-need-to-know/">previously mentioned</a> it features new cinematic sequences and epilogue scenes, the <em>Mass Effect 3: Extended Cut</em> gives fans seeking further clarity into the final events of <em>Mass Effect 3 </em>deeper insights into how their personal journey concludes. To experience the <em>Mass Effect 3</em>: <em>Extended Cut</em>, fans will need to download the DLC and load their last autosave point in the game before the final mission on Earth. The <em>Mass Effect 3: Extended Cut</em> is available for download now on XboxLIVE, PlayStation Network in North America and on Origin for PC. <strong>PlayStation 3 users in Europe will be able to experience the <em>Mass Effect 3: Extended Cut</em> by downloading the DLC through the PlayStation Network on July 4th</strong>.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Before reading please be aware that this may include SPOILERS for some people. </strong>In order to remain spoiler free the ending of the post that includes the spoiler info is underneath the image below. The Mass Effect 3: Extended Cut will be a downloadable content pack that will expand upon the events at the end of Mass Effect 3.<span id="more-7518"></span> Through additional cinematic sequences and epilogue scenes, the Extended Cut will include deeper insight to Commander Shepard’s journey based on player choices during the war against the Reapers.</p>
<p><strong>The Extended Cut will be available to download at no additional charge on June 26th on Xbox 360 and PC and PlayStation 3.</strong></p>
<p>Here&#8217;s the important bits.</p>
<ul>
<li>The Extended Cut requires roughly 1.9 gigabytes of storage.</li>
<li>The Extended Cut is an expansion of the original endings to Mass Effect 3. It does not fundamentally change the endings, but rather it expands on the meaning of the original endings, and reveals greater detail on the impact of player decisions.</li>
</ul>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://ghoststorm.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2012/04/MassEffect3.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-6750" title="MassEffect3" src="http://ghoststorm.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2012/04/MassEffect3.jpg" alt="" width="615" height="300" /></a></p>
<p>[SPOILERS] To experience the Extended Cut, load a save game from before the attack on the Cerberus Base and play through to the end of the game. The Extended Cut endings will differ depending on choices made throughout the Mass Effect series, so multiple playthroughs with a variety of different decisions will be required to experience the variety of possibilities offered by the new content.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Strengthen your forces and battle for new territories with the next downloadable content pack for <em><a href="http://tidd.ly/2fb79f7e">Mass Effect™ 3</a> </em>multiplayer! Available to download at no additional charge*, the <em>Mass Effect 3: Rebellion </em><em>Pack </em>adds two brand-new maps, a new team objective and a new equipment slot to the game’s critically-acclaimed cooperative experience. <span id="more-7153"></span>The <em>Mass Effect 3: Rebellion Pack</em> will also introduce new unlockable characters, including the Vorcha, ex-Cerberus operatives and Male Quarians. Also available are all new weapons and items that can be obtained through reinforcement packs in the game’s multiplayer store.</p>
<p><em>The Mass Effect 3: Rebellion Pack</em> will be available starting May 29 on XboxLIVE and the <a href="http://clkuk.tradedoubler.com/click?p(123350)a(1721342)g(19995808)">Origin</a>™ client software and on PlayStation Network in North America on May 29 and in Europe on May 30.</p>
<p>The <em>Mass Effect 3: Rebellion Pack </em>includes the following content:</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Two New Action-Packed Maps – </strong>Land on <em>Firebase Jade</em>, located in a Salarian STG base on Sur’Kesh and fight to control <em>Firebase Goddess</em>on the Asari homeworld of Thessia.</li>
<li><strong>Six Powerful New Unlockable Characters – </strong>Level and promote six new unlockable characters, including the ex-Cerberus <em>Adept</em> and<em>Vanguard, </em>the <em>Vorcha Soldier</em> and <em>Sentinel</em> or the Male <em>Quarian Engineer</em>and <em>Infiltrator. </em></li>
<li><strong>New In-Mission Objective – </strong>Randomly occurring during waves 3, 6 and 10, this new objective will demand that teams retrieve a high priority package and securely escort it to a designated extraction zone on each map.</li>
<li> <strong>New Gear Slot –</strong> A new slot will be available on the equipment screen, offering players a persistent gameplay bonus that will not expire after the end of a match. These new items will vary from weapon upgrades to character enhancements and will be available through reinforcement packs.</li>
<li><strong>Lethal New Weapons – </strong>Eliminate the enemy with deadly new weapons, including the <em>Cerberus Harrier, Krysae Sniper Rifle,</em> and <em>Reegar Carbine</em>.</li>
</ul>
<p>As part of the <em>Mass Effect 3 Galaxy at War**</em> system, success in the cooperative  multiplayer experience in <em>Mass Effect 3</em> links back to the player’s single-player campaign, helping Commander Shepard rally the forces of the galaxy to eliminate the Reaper threat once and for all. Multiplayer puts players in the role of a team of elite Special Forces soldiers sent to protect resources and assets that can help the greater war effort.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Today I received an email saying that I had been chosen to take part in the Mass Effect 3 Multiplayer, via its demo on the Xbox 360.<span id="more-5925"></span></p>
<p>So I loaded it up and away I went. Before we get to the various game modes lets have a look at the character aspect.</p>
<p>The choices available at this time for your character are:</p>
<ul>
<li>Adept &#8211; Human Male</li>
<li>Soldier &#8211;  Human Male</li>
<li>Engineer - Human Male</li>
<li>Sentinel - Human Female</li>
<li>Infiltrator - Human Female</li>
<li>Vanguard - Human Female</li>
</ul>
<p>Each of those come with their own &#8216;powers&#8217; such as Biotic Charge, Shockwave or even Sticky Grenades so there is plenty of choices to make when the game goes on sale.  The next choice is usually weapons and there isn&#8217;t much to choose here as you only get one 1 free pack the others are bought with points but I am not sure if these points are earned in the game via single player or online in a similar fashion to exchanging your XP for new weapons etc.</p>
<p>Then we have Appearance. This gives you 6 options to make your own unique online presence.</p>
<ul>
<li>Primary Color</li>
<li>Highlight Color</li>
<li>Secondary Color</li>
<li>Pattern</li>
<li>Pattern Color</li>
<li>Lights</li>
</ul>
<p>At this time the only options available were Primary Color and Highlight Color so I went for a Dark Red with a Yellow Highlight which gave me a kind of a fiery look an I think it looks neat <img src='http://ghoststorm.co.uk/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_smile.gif' alt=':)' class='wp-smiley' />  When you highlight the greyed out options you will see a message that says</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;Customization options for this character are unlocked with class XP bonus cards, available in reinforcement packs.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p>If you are wondering what reinforcement packs are then here is some official info on them:</p>
<blockquote><p>Reinforcement Packs represent &#8220;supply drops&#8221; that players can earn for use in Mass Effect 3 multiplayer matches. In effect, each pack contains a random assortment of weapons and weapon upgrades, character unlocks, and in-game consumables such as damage and health boosts.</p></blockquote>

<p>It is a typical &#8216;Horde&#8217; type gameplay which you can see in the likes of Gears of War and even Saints Row The Third where you fight off waves of enemies and each wave gets more and more difficult. Then when you have Any Challenge selected from the Quick Match screen you will not only have Hordes of enemies to fight off but also other aspects to contend with. I&#8217;m not saying its boring or anything &#8211; it is indeed fun, if you have the right person fighting along side you and not someone who prefers to just run off and let you die.  You will also soon notice that the best way to survive  is to stay together. If you do find yourself bleeding out you can either wait and hope a teammate can revive you or if fortunate, use your own medi-gel for a self-revive.</p>
<p>To keep the battles moving around the map and to stop your team from bedding in there are <em>occasional</em> monetary challenges that pop up, like taking out specific officers in a tight time limit or securing an uplink terminal in a very open area. The idea of tempting players away from a safe haven for some extra cash is great and it will sure cause many an argument in teams on the harder settings.</p>
